The Foolio murder trial continues to draw attention as its second session kicks off with key pieces of evidence, including a Yungeen Ace song and an interrogation video.

On April 22, opening statements commenced in the trial involving four men accused of murdering Jacksonville rapper Foolio in June 2024.

The prosecution claims that Isaiah Chance, Sean Gathright, Rashad Murphy, and Davion Murphy were involved in the killing, allegedly tied to a violent rivalry between Foolio’s 6 Block crew and gangs associated with Yungeen Ace, namely Top Killers and 1200.

Prosecutors introduced Yungeen Ace’s track “Game Over” as evidence, suggesting it highlighted animosity between the involved parties.

A pivotal moment in court was the presentation of interrogation footage featuring Davion Murphy. In the clip, recorded shortly after his arrest, Murphy is seen mimicking shooting a gun repeatedly when left alone in the room by detectives.

Authorities accuse Gathright, Rashad Murphy, and Davion Murphy of fatally shooting Foolio outside a Holiday Inn in Tampa, Florida. Meanwhile, Chance is alleged to have orchestrated the crime by tracking Foolio’s movements and passing his location to the attackers.

The trial follows the earlier conviction of Alicia Andrews, who was charged as the fifth individual implicated in the murder. Last November, she was found guilty of manslaughter but has yet to be sentenced due to delays.

Her sentencing was postponed after Florida’s Second District Court of Appeals removed the presiding judge, citing potential bias as argued by the defense.
